Set Your Foundation with the Right Tools and Materials
Begin by gathering high-quality lag bolts, heavy-duty anchors, and a sturdy drill. Remember, using inferior hardware is like building a house on quicksand—your storage won’t withstand the weight over time. I once started a project with cheap lag bolts, and after a few months, the overhead rack sagged. Switching to reputable brands and the proper size solved the problem permanently. Choose anchors rated for concrete or masonry if attaching to brick or stone, and always match bolt length and diameter to the weight load.
Identify and Mark Your Mounting Points
Visualize your storage layout using a level and measuring tape. Mark precise locations for the lag bolts, ensuring even weight distribution. Think of it like attaching a heavy mirror—misaligned holes mean wobbly support. For my garage, I used painter’s tape to delineate where each bolt would go, then double-checked measurements. Mark through a template or printout for accuracy. Proper markings prevent misdrilled holes that could compromise the entire system.
Pre-Drill Holes with Precision
Pre-drilling is critical to avoid cracking or splitting the material. Use a drill bit that matches the diameter of your lag bolts—around 1/8 to 3/16 inch for most applications. Apply steady pressure and drill perpendicularly, like driving a nail straight into wood. I once drilled at an angle, which caused my shelf to sag prematurely. Pre-drilling ensures clean, accurate holes, making insertion smoother and reducing damage risk.
Attach Hardware Securely and Test Support
Insert the lag bolts into the pre-drilled holes and tighten with a wrench or socket set. Do this gradually, alternating between bolts to ensure even tightening. Picture screwing together a LEGO model—tighten too quickly on one side, and everything tilts. After installation, test the stability by gently loading weight or applying pressure. I recall installing a heavy overhead bin, and a quick shake revealed loose bolts—tightening fixed the issue. This step guarantees your system can handle the intended load safely.
Seal and Protect Your Investment
Apply a weatherproof sealant or paint around bolts if exposed to moisture, preventing rust. Think of it like coating a bike frame—prolongs lifespan and maintains strength. In my garage, I used a silicone sealant around all hardware, which kept the connections intact for years. This final step preserves your setup, ensuring longevity and safety for years to come.

Keeping It Working: Tools and Routine Maintenance for Built-Ins
To ensure your custom-built storage and vanities remain functional and attractive over the years, investing in the right tools and adopting a regular maintenance schedule is crucial. I personally rely on a high-quality cordless drill like the DeWalt DCD996 for all my installations. Its brushless motor and variable speed control give me the precision needed for securing heavy-duty fasteners without stripping the head. Additionally, a torque wrench is indispensable when tightening bolts for vanities and shelving—avoiding under-tightening that compromises stability or over-tightening that damages materials. Proper fastener torque is often overlooked but plays a vital role in longevity.
Maintaining your built-ins also involves routine inspections. Every few months, check for loose screws or bolts, especially in high-traffic or humid areas. Use a digital level to verify that shelves and counters remain plumb, adjusting as needed to prevent wobbling. In damp environments, apply a moisture-resistant sealant around joints and hardware to stave off corrosion and warping. For example, I use a silicone-based sealant around my bathroom vanities to ensure a tight, waterproof fit that withstands daily exposure to moisture.
How do I maintain built-in storage over time?
Implementing a consistent care routine, including cleaning with gentle cleansers and inspecting hardware, extends the lifespan of your built-in features. I recommend creating a maintenance checklist—checking fasteners, lubricating hinges, and sealing surfaces quarterly. The hidden support rails in floating vanities, for instance, benefit from periodic inspection to prevent sagging. Additionally, avoid overloading shelves beyond their rated capacity; this can be prevented with a simple weight testing using a bathroom scale to simulate maximum load.
